Verdantas Acquires Sherwood Design Engineers to Bolster Green Infrastructure
Verdantas is expanding its environmental consulting footprint by acquiring San Francisco-based Sherwood Design Engineers, a firm known for integrating natural systems into urban development. The deal adds 120 specialists to the Verdantas roster, enhancing expertise in climate resilience, water resources, and ecological restoration across the U.S. and Latin America.

Jesse Kropelnicki, CEO of Verdantas, noted that the acquisition aligns with the firm’s strategy to deliver integrated solutions for communities facing complex environmental challenges. Bry Sarte, founder of Sherwood, emphasized that joining the larger organization will provide the resources necessary to scale the firm’s impact. The transaction was facilitated by 2020 Environmental Group, which served as the exclusive M&A advisor to Sherwood, while Sterling Investment Partners supported the deal as part of its ongoing investment in the technical consulting space.
